Job Description
· Daily cash positioning including reporting of prior day’s final position.
· Monthly reporting showing details of liquidity and capital structure.
· Calculating monthly interest and bank fees including variance analysis.
· Providing quarterly deliverables to Financial Reporting to support public disclosures.
· Preparing compliance packages required by lenders.
· Assist with maintenance of annual cash forecast and five-year cash flow, balance sheet and capital table.
· Present findings and results from each of these reports to members of the Finance team.
· Educational background should include coursework in accounting, finance and economics. Familiarity with business-oriented mathematics and statistics is a plus.
· Self-motivated critical thinker with the ability to learn and develop independently.
· Effective level of communication, both verbal and written.
· Desires a treasury related career path.
· Detail oriented with a high level of personal organization.
· Ability to prioritize multiple deliverables.
· Proficient with Microsoft Office products (Word, Excel, Powerpoint).
· Familiarity with OneStream and commercial banking platforms a plus
